PDF Automotive Software Engineering Free Download PDF

That’s why it’s crucial to find a reliable provider and choose the right development tools and frameworks for building a successful embedded project. Talking about the list of embedded software development tools, we cannot but mention integrated development environments. All the above-mentioned tools are needed for creating your embedded software. But it would be extremely inconvenient to use them separately, adding another layer of complexity to the project. The custom automotive industry software solutions we develop are designed to improve customer retention and acquisition through client automation tools and streamlined database management. Designs can now be optimized by balancing different application functions and incorporating software verification at the systems level.

From software architecture design and improving automotive software development to providing embedded software. With the increased usage of connected digital systems and platforms, the need for scalability became mandatory. The number of vehicles and devices simultaneously connected to the automotive cloud platforms surges, and scalability became one of the core system requirements. Not only for resiliency but also to reduce costs and allow enterprises to pay only for used resources. It has to be paired with global availability, made possible through hybrid and multi-cloud deployments, spanning from company premises, through well-known European, and US providers such as AWS or Azure to the blooming Chinese market.

automotive software development tools

A year later, famous entrepreneur, Elon Musk, decided to invest in this dream of building electric vehicles for the masses. Delivering software development services for many companies in the automotive industry, we are a certified partner and trusted service provider. Combine input from all engineering disciplines with collaborative requirements specification, management, and change control. Rely on codebeamer’s built-in modeling tool, the suspect links functionality to uncover the impact of changes, and test coverage analysis for QA monitoring.

Automotive Software Solutions and Services

Experienced blockchain developers at Avenga create decentralized solutions and apps for our clients to ensure enhanced traceability and the security of transactions and data. We increase the productivity of engineering resources through AI and analytics. In particular, we’ll help you better utilize lifecycle data and use AI to improve requirements management and automate repetitive tasks to free up the engineers’ time.

automotive software development tools

Time Partition Testing combines a systematic and very graphic modelling technique for test cases with a fully automatic test execution in different environments and automatic test evaluation in a unique way. This chapter discusses the state of the art in model management and evolution and sketches what is still necessary for models to become as usable and used as software. The development of a Graphical User Interface tool which takes the MATLAB model as input and checks for any violation of MAAB guidelines, and is developed using MATLAB m-script. We combine the industry’s best service delivery standards with unprecedented solution personalization practices.

Future of pharma & life sciences: What to expect in 2023

Increases in functional requirements of software allows vehicle software architects to consider new types of software workloads. Changes in vehicle architectures along with feature-rich silicon platforms, presents vehicle architects the opportunity to consolidate functionality. Architects and system integrators have the flexibility to consolidate onto one ECU functions that were previously on separate ECUs.

The custom software developed at Orases provides manufacturers and dealerships within the automotive industry features and functionality unmatched by the competition. In addition to reducing overhead costs and automating processes, our custom software is designed to attract users and convert them into leads. Get the most out of your custom automotive industry software by working with Orases to develop a product strategy that will yield the best results before and after deployment. Our custom software development team have years of experience creating and implementing successful product strategies for auto dealers, manufacturers and more.

  • Allowing 3rd parties to be able to integrate the completely new application and showcase them on the infotainment screen opens completely new revenue streams for the OEMs.
  • The topic of highly automated driving is the focus of many automobile manufacturers’ development activities.
  • This software enables the optimal distribution of application functions to CPUs and IPs inside different SoCs and microcontrollers in an ECU, maximizing hardware performance.
  • It also supports multiple nesting e.g. when a JS script is embedded in an HTML document, in which another HTML code is embedded, inside which JavaScript is embedded.
  • Moving from a hardware-centric world to a software-defined world is easier said than done.

In the face of growing environmental concerns, vehicle concepts of the future must leave behind internal combustion engines and rely on alternative power systems. Electric drives are the ideal solution because they are independent from finite resources and operate without emissions if they run on electricity from renewable energies. As the electrification of vehicles continues, current developments focus on fail-safe and limp modes, increasing ranges and the efficiency of electric drivetrains, reducing charging times, and improving storage and charging facilities. A user-friendly real-time debug monitor and data visualization tool that enables runtime configuration and tuning of embedded software applications.

What is Embedded Software?

The hardware model of the complete digital baseband processor is modeled using verilog HDL code. DSPACE offers a complete and integrated development environment for embedded software and systems. Our hardware and software tools are convenient to use and will save you valuable development time and money, whether you apply them throughout the entire process or only for individual project phases. DSPACE systems support established development and validation processes, also with respect to functional safety requirements, and give you ways to adapt your process chains to new challenging needs. Selected cooperation partners from the dSPACE Partner Program complete the portfolio with their own state-of-the-art products. With constant innovations, key technologies and standards, and dedicated service and support, dSPACE helps you achieve long-term success and put your visions into action.

For the general audience, most of the ML is a black box, which accepts data and responds with prediction or identification. With explainable AI, the problem resolution path can be exposed to customers and stakeholders, making the bottlenecks and reasons for wrong reasoning visible. The ADAS systems require very-low latency to operate – as the reaction time in case of emergency has to be measured in milliseconds.

Yocto – the standard for embedded systems OS building

We have observed the automotive industry from very close quarters for more than 14 years and contributed to its growth by partnering with pioneers of the industry. Generate test cases based on requirements, and maintain traceability across quality assurance activities. Execute parametrized test cases manually or automatically, monitor test coverage real time, and automate bug reporting during testing.

automotive software development tools

Democratic access to the data across the enterprise helps to build better products faster and easier while having a single point for data storage makes the operations easier. Storing the heterogeneous data in data lakes and data meshes is easier for developers and data scientists. Each department generates and gathers enormous amounts of data about customers, products, or the environment.

Software

This is most often a case when a vehicle gets stolen, or a customer tries to avoid higher charges for going abroad. With location-based services, the rental or fleet company is immediately notified of such violation and can act appropriately. Learn to simplify your motor control application development using dedicated motor control libraries for automotive applications while reducing automotive software development companies the time to market. Beat the competition by automating delivery pipelines, testing, and manual processes to scale opportunities and eliminate threats on the go. Learn from NetApp experts about how to leverage our toolset to advance innovation for connected cars. The launch comes on the heels of the company’s debut of Incredibuild10, its most advanced Dev Acceleration Platform.

Access Secure Information About Our Products

Our VDK has been used by NXP’s teams to develop their S32Z/E enablement software and firmware. With trends in automotive electronics dramatically affecting software development, the requirement demands of software will only increase. These requirements are affecting the https://globalcloudteam.com/ way the vehicle architectures are being implemented so OEMs need to start thinking about having a more holistic approach to vehicle architecture. Arm and its ecosystem of software partners can address any level of the software stack to help deliver a complete solution.

In the era of Smart Everything—where devices are getting smarter and everything is connected—Synopsys technology is at the heart of innovations that are changing the way we live. Read on to get the latest look at trends in semiconductor chip design, verification, IP integration, and software security and quality. Learn about the ins and outs of electronic design automation from our industry-leading experts and how silicon and software are powering the automotive, artificial intelligence, 5G, cloud and IoT markets.

It also supports multiple nesting e.g. when a JS script is embedded in an HTML document, in which another HTML code is embedded, inside which JavaScript is embedded. The organization of information in these layers provides correct refactoring. A Czech company JetBrains created this IDE specifically for developers working with Python. Certainly, when everyone decides at the same time to do a similar shift, it can get complicated rapidly.

Proprietary or commercial software vendors are the most common providers of software elements to address functional safety requirements. So today, for designing an ECU that requires safety certification at the system level to ASIL D or even ASIL B requirements, most likely this work would be done with a commercial OS vendor with experience in safety certification. In the short-term, and possibly for quite some time, there will be a huge reliance on software partners that have those software solutions and previously certified software elements such as hypervisors and RTOSes.

Parking Is Plain Sailing… Provided That Your Car Is Equipped with Automated Valet Parking

With today’s highly competitive EV market and fast-paced design cycles, reducing development costs and increasing time-to-market require deploying new development tools. Synopsys VDKs enable software development to occur much earlier in the design cycle. Auto manufacturers developing automotive software as well as independent software vendors can utilize Incredibuild for Automotive when helping build next-generation automotive technologies such as self-driving cars and smart cockpits.

دیدگاهتان را بنویسید

نشانی ایمیل شما منتشر نخواهد شد.

شما میتوانید از برچسب ها و ویژگی های HTML هم استفاده کنید: <a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<s> <strike> <strong>

*

code

بالا